In a shocking incident that has rattled the local political landscape, shots were fired at the residence of an Indiana politician, who subsequently discovered a note reading “No data centers.” This alarming event, which took place late last week, has raised concerns over political violence and the increasing tensions surrounding local government decisions, particularly those related to technology and infrastructure development.
According to reports, the politician, whose identity has not been disclosed for security reasons, was home when the shots were fired. Fortunately, no injuries were reported, but the event has reignited discussions about the safety of elected officials and the potential for violence stemming from political disagreements. The presence of the note suggests that the incident may be tied to ongoing debates over proposed data centers in the region, a contentious issue that has divided community opinion and raised questions about economic growth versus environmental impact.
Context of the Incident
The proposal for data centers in Indiana has been met with both enthusiasm and opposition. Proponents argue that these facilities could bring significant economic benefits, including job creation and increased tax revenue, while opponents raise concerns about environmental degradation and the strain on local resources. The political figure targeted in this incident has been a vocal advocate for responsible development, aiming to balance economic interests with community well-being.
Local law enforcement officials are currently investigating the shooting, and authorities have emphasized the seriousness of threats against public officials. In recent years, there has been a marked increase in threats and acts of violence directed at politicians across the United States, a trend that has alarmed many. The FBI and other agencies have reported a rise in domestic extremism and politically motivated violence, leading to heightened security measures for elected officials.
